Former Oregon running back Dante Dowdell announced his commitment to Nebraska on Saturday.
Dowdell a four-star prospect in the Rivals transfer rankings, and he is rated as the No. 6 RB and No. 88 overall player in this year's transfer portal cycle.
Dowdell spent the 2023 season with the Ducks as a true freshman and played in six games, where he rushed for 90 yards and one touchdown on 17 carries. He left the Ducks seeking more opportunity outside of their loaded backfield. The Mississippi native will have four years to play three seasons.
Dowdell is the third transfer Nebraska has taken this offseason, joining cornerback Blye Hill from St. Francis (PA), an FCS program, and receiver Isaiah Neyor, formerly of Texas and Wyoming.
